Ice Hole Posted September 25, 2019 Share Posted September 25, 2019 This is from the TC page: "We have taken steps to protect your Current Version Save Files but please ensure you follow the TIME CAPSULE instructions carefully. Current update saves will not work earlier (Unsupported) updates." Indicates that Current Version Save Files are protected. Seems it should be using the steam cloud to retain our save files. If this setting is turned off then I would copy the hinterland save folder that is located in a user hidden directory. I am almost done touring Mystery Lake and will be updating to the next build. Plan on making a save file in the build and then revert back to the first and see if the old save is returned.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Ice Hole Posted September 25, 2019 Share Posted September 25, 2019 Saved a game in the early access build at Camp Office. Loaded the Silent Hunter. Entered the Quonset Hut and the game now auto saves. Returned to the early access and loaded the save and now at Camp Office. It seems the saves are being preserved between builds.
